Too many stories! Some sad ones too! One name Jason Hill was regular and got started down the wrong path hope he is alive? As a kid he slept under the pool tables every weekend. Someone didn't pay and got the sock and cue ball treatment. The place was rough. Coin vending machine schemes. Dealers, pimps and hookers were regulars. The place was gray from smoke. Lots of money and action. BMore max and Tony Watson running around. Leggs, cigar tom, Nate, geese, newdecker, Boggs brothers, strawberry, bus driver, tom tom, Newport's and reggie

Then china doll and cowboy Bob. Cliff Macklin owned the place but would call the house man to see if it was clear to come into his own place cause people where looking for him. No joke! Pop a cap in him on sight.

The place has so much history it unbelievable. One guy made news doing 140 on 95 throughing beer cans at the po po trying not to get caught.

Baldwin has more stories and backed more big matches. A millionaire that darn near lived in the pool room.
